The 1984 Winter Olympics, officially known as the XIV Olympic Winter Games, were a winter multi-sport event which was celebrated in Sarajevo in Bosnia and Herzegovina, which was at the time part of the Socialist Federal Republic of Yugoslavia. Other candidate cities were Sapporo, Japan; and Gothenburg, Sweden. It was the first Winter Games and the second Olympics held in a socialist country (the first was the 1980 Summer Olympics in Moscow). City venues
* Asim Ferhatovic Stadion - opening ceremonies * Zetra Ice Hall - figure skating, ice hockey, closing ceremonies * Zetra Ice Rink - speed skating * Skenderija II Hall - ice hockey
Mountain venues
* Mount Bjelašnica - men's alpine skiing * Mount Jahorina - women's alpine skiing * Igman, Veliko Polje - cross-country skiing, Nordic combined, biathlon * Igman, Malo Polje - * Trebevic - bobsleigh, luge
